Output 66f0853dc9ab39b642e4c5000411f1cf731a2da7c143a7afff899832f0e27724:9

value
40346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43986310eeac9bc6cefc958fc8704fb9a6c43de OP_EQUAL
address
3KaZGzYpSoangZvLpsQ6E8TWgcgDHkM3Y1
transaction
66f0853dc9ab39b642e4c5000411f1cf731a2da7c143a7afff899832f0e27724